Dois lavadores de dinheiro da cidade de Nova York fazem um rápido negócio de drogas. As coisas dão errado, pois os policiais corruptos estão envolvidos. Um dos amigos sofre de amnésia durant... Strong performances, intimidating villains, claustrophobic situations; this level of authenticity is very seldom (if ever) found in Hollywood where they go for safe and cheap thrills. There's no superheroes here, no easy resolutions, no good guys. It's all gritty and grey and asphyxiating in its determination to drive the plot forward without relying on the usual stupid (albeit entertaining) tropes.
Somehow, in this age when we've already seen all there's to be seen in such a thoroughly explored genre as this (crime, drugs, gangs), this movie still manages to deliver and I applaud it.
All in all, Realistic: 8, Immersive: 8, Entertaining: 5, Resourceful: 7, Suspenseful: 7.

- CuriosidadesThe 400 oz. gold bar shown in the beginning would cost over half a million US dollars. The amount of cash required would be much more than the two small bags shown. Each stack of 100 dollar bills is 10k. 50 of these would be needed. That would require a briefcase.
- Erros de gravaçãoAt around the 1 hour 26 mark when the corrupt officer shoots Debo in the head Debo's blood is splattered on the window next to him. However, when the officer collects the money from the boot of the car the blood is no longer on the window.
